WYATT, District Judge.
A separate trial was ordered by the Court, on motion of plaintiffs and without opposition by defendant, of the issues raised by the Second Defense in the answer. Fed.R.Civ.P. 42(b). These issues relate to whether the provisions of a certain circular, a ticket and a receipt delivered to plaintiffs are sufficient to absolve defendant of liability. The separate trial was ordered because if the Second Defense is sustained it is a bar to the action...
